DEFIANT HUERTA.
REFUSES TO RECEIVE UNITED STATES ENVOY. Br T«]«gnii}i.—Press Association—OobtilbM (ficc. August, 8, 10.S0 p.m.) Washington, August 7, Presidont Wilson, recognising that the Mexican situation is becoming more nnd moro intolerable, has appointed Mr. John Lind his personal representative, and commissioned him to approach President Huerta with the object of procuring from him information as to tho prospect o£ suppressing tho rebellion in Mexico. Hucrta (refuses to receivo tho. American Envoy, and declares that ho will ignore him if ho aiTives in tho country.
